From a red-carpet Halloween costume to the fireworks of New Year's, Karin Kallmaker is adding a holiday layer to her literary cake with short stories inspired by her classics and recent novels. It's a baker's dozen buffet of pure holiday deliciousness.

Join her for a Car Pool family table Thanksgiving and Paperback Romance small town concert. A Warming Trend North Pole wonderland and Maybe Next Time Hawaiian Christmas. A reality show holiday bake-off with Wild Things. And Simply the Best ever New Year's Day. Every story will wrap you in family, friendships, and romance, all with a holiday bow on top.

Karin Kallmaker's delightful and moving short stories have won Lambda Literary and Golden Crown awards and are sure to have you falling in love with her characters all over again.
